A murder investigation began after a child found dead in a pool in a Queensland house failed to drown.
The four-year-old boy was found dead on August 29th at Munburra house in central Queensland.
« An autopsy and a scientific examination have now shown that the cause of death was incompatible with drowning, and therefore the police have started an investigation into murder, » said the police on Wednesday.
« The circumstances, how and why if the child was in the pool are under investigation. «
A local media report of the child’s death at the time indicated that the child was pulled out of the water around 5:00 p.m.
There was one « Desperate CPR effort to resuscitate him » before the paramedics arrived, the Daily Mercury reported.
